  2. You can have a band put around the pouch or you can get Stomaphyx where they tighten up your pouch and stoma. These only help if the problem is that your stoma has stretched so you don't get that full feeling any more. If the problem is that you need more malabsorption than RnY gives you, there is the DS. If the problem is in your head and you won't do the work, eat a lot of slider foods, don't exercise, sabotage yourself, etc. ain't nothing you can revise to that you won't learn how to get around.

I don't know about older members, but I have seen time and time again people coming here and to other WLS boards and saying things like: I was going to get WLS a year ago but I got so encouraged by losing weight on the pre-op diet, that I decided to do it on my own. But I gained back X pounds and here I am to finally get it done. I'm really sorry I didn't get it done a year ago. OTOH, I've never seen anyone on a weight loss board say they were going to get surgery but lost weight on the pre-op diet and it's two years later and they are so happy they didn't get surgery. And I'm on a lot of boards where people who haven't had WLS are constantly talking about diet and exercise including a triathlon board where people do lose weight from the training. Personally, I believe that some insurances require a pre-op diet just to get people to change their minds about the surgery and save some money. They know that diets don't work and they know we have a history of dieting without success. There is no clinical data saying people who do these diets pre-op are more successful than those who don't. So there is no *medical* reason to insist on it. It's all part of their delay and deny game.

  18. It varies Marsha. I paid $17000 for my sleeve in Northern CA (an expensive part of the country). In Mexico, it typically costs around $10,000. There are surgeons in the US who do it cheaper, but I wasn't interested in them for various reasons. However, that's for a virgin sleeve. A revision is going to cost more.

  22. If the sleeve is made small enough (around 40-60 cc) then it is extremely hard to stretch out. The stretchy part is gone, basically. The tissues do relax some (there is some scientific name for this, but I can't remember it). But some surgeons are still making them about 2x that size and those people do have more issues with weight regain, whether pregnancy enters the picture or not. So be sure to check on that.
